US foreign policy technologies are not changing, said political scientist Alexander Nosovich, commenting on the war in Iran.
"The main thing was and remains the bet on the fifth column in the targeted country,— Nosovich writes in the telegram channel. — Only now this rate has to be provided by external aggression. One fifth column is no longer able to provide results: the era of color revolutions, which were effective when the United States was at the peak of its power, has ended. Now the expression returns to its original context. "We are marching on Madrid in four army columns, and the fifth column is waiting for us in Madrid.""
In the USA in After all, Iran's main bet now is the overthrow of power in Tehran and the arrival of those who are ready to surrender the country to the Americans, Nosovich said.
"If this does not happen, we will either have to nullify the war and declare victory without achieving anything, or launch a land invasion and occupation of the country, as at the beginning of the century in Iraq. Both will be a heavy political defeat for Trump," the political scientist added.
Earlier, CNN said that the CIA is working on supplying weapons to Kurdish forces in order to provoke an uprising in Iran. It is noted that the administration of US President Donald Trump is actively negotiating with Iranian opposition groups and Kurdish leaders in Iraq on providing them with military support.
The Axios portal, for its part, reported that the US president spoke with the leaders of the two main Kurdish groups in Iraq — Masoud Barzani and Bafel Talabani the day after the start of the bombing of Iran.
The statement: "We are marching on Madrid with four army columns, and the fifth column is waiting for us in Madrid" belongs to the Spanish General Emilio Mole. The phrase was uttered during the Spanish Civil War, in October 1936, when nationalist troops were advancing on the capital. By "fifth column" Mola meant Franco's secret supporters inside Madrid, who were supposed to support the offensive from inside the city. This expression has become a household name for internal enemies or secret agents of influence.
